Manchester City pocket yet another win as they regained their second spot in the Premier League standings after beating Everton 3-0 on Sunday at home. 

While Raheem Sterling fired the first goal of the game just before the halftime break, Rodri and Bernardo Silva added to the mark in the 55th and 86th minute. Everton who are without a win in the last 6 games, were struggling against the overpowering Manchester City throughout the game.

Pep Guardiola's men with 8 wins from 12 games are only behind Chelsea in the EPL table.
